[ET Trac] [Einstein Toolkit] #1771: Improve performance of CarpetInterp2 interpolation

Einstein Toolkit trac-noreply at einsteintoolkit.org
Mon May 4 06:43:15 CDT 2015


#1771: Improve performance of CarpetInterp2 interpolation
-------------------------+--------------------------------------------------
 Reporter:  hinder       |       Owner:  eschnett           
     Type:  enhancement  |      Status:  new                
 Priority:  minor        |   Milestone:                     
Component:  Carpet       |     Version:  development version
 Keywords:               |  
-------------------------+--------------------------------------------------
 The branch
 https://bitbucket.org/eschnett/carpet/branch/ianhinder/fasterp_opt#diff
 contains an optimisation to the CarpetInterp2 interpolation routine which
 improved the performance of Llama interpatch interpolation in my test by a
 factor of 5.  I did this a while ago, and haven't looked at it recently.
 Before merging, the following should be done:
 1. Check that is applies cleanly to the current version of Carpet
 2. Decide whether the vectorisation pragmas need to be protected by Cactus
 preprocessor guards
 Or any other changes which people think might be necessary.
 This should wait until after the upcoming (May 2015) release of the ET.

-- 
Ticket URL: <https://trac.einsteintoolkit.org/ticket/1771>
Einstein Toolkit <http://einsteintoolkit.org>
The Einstein Toolkit


More information about the Trac mailing list